Long Beach will see a return of last week's light rainfall through Thursday, according to the seven-day forecast from drone-powered weather service Saildrone. Today's forecast shows the greatest chance of rain at 95 percent, with expected rainfall of 0.31 inches.

The immediate forecast also has cool temperatures in store for today. Temperatures will reach just 61 degrees on Wednesday, then make way for milder weather from Thursday to Friday.

Skies will be mostly cloudy on Friday through Saturday. Winds will reach a modest high of 14 mph today, with daily top speeds in the single digits the rest of the week.
